以美洲灰桶尺寸:325*330*480为例 算栈板尺寸:按照一托18个为例
一托18个的尺寸为:3个长“3*325=975”,3个宽“3*330=990”,如果有装箱量要求, 那么此栈板可以做成非标栈板,尺寸为1000*990*130/120/110/100,此托货物总尺寸 为1000*990*(2*480+130/120/110/100),那么把这个尺寸输到装柜软件中计算出装 箱量;如果没有装箱量要求,此栈板可以做成日本标准栈板:1100*1100*130/120, 同样算出总尺寸,输入装柜软件,计算装箱量。

集装箱简介
集装箱的种类
集装箱分为20尺柜、40平柜、40高柜、45高柜、冷高柜
常用集装箱
常用集装箱为20GP(General Purpose)、40GP、40HQ(High Cube) 标准20尺平柜:5800*2340*2340mm,凸角尺寸115*115*80mm,横杠突出20mm 标准40尺平柜:11800*2340*2340mm,凸角横杠尺寸同上 标准40尺高柜:11800*2340*2680mm,凸角横杠尺寸同上 标准45尺高柜:13500*2340*2680mm,凸角横杠尺寸同上 标准冷高柜:11550*2290*2500mm(部分柜子不标准,需同货代确认)

GENERAL INFORMATION1.1 General Safety PrecautionsPlease read this Operations and Maintenance Manual prior to installing, operating and maintaining your Techmine Hydraulic Belt Lifter. This document should be included as a reference in the work permit, safe work procedure or equivalent documentation used at your facilities.i. The Portable Hydraulic Belt Lifter is only to be operated with a Techmine Hydraulic PowerPack. The Techmine Power Pack has been carefully designed to ensure equipmentoverload is prevented and to automatically synchronize the hydraulic cylinders, ensuringan even lift by compensating for uneven loading.ii. The Portable Belt Lifter is intended for use on a STATIONARY and DE-ENERGISED belt conveyor. Prior to installing and operating the Lifter, please ensure that the conveyordrives are ISOLATED and that the belt and/or brakes are CLAMPED/LOCKED to preventmovement.iii. Visually inspect all equipment prior to use. If damage is evident, do not use the lifter and tag “Out of Service”. Never attempt to repair the lifter yourself, always contact Techmineor approved agent for repair, replacement or assistance.iv. All lifting equipment should be thoroughly inspected on a quarterly basis by a qualified and competent rigger. It is recommended to tag the inspected and approved equipmentusing a colour coded tagging system or similar.v. The belt lifter is rated to safely lift a load of certain tonnage. The rated capacity is indicated on the products identification plates and also clearly marked as a rated Working Load Limit(WLL).vi. Never adjust the pressure relief settings on the Hydraulic Power Pack. Exceeding the specified maximum pressure as indicated on the products identification plates may causeinjury and/or equipment damage.vii. Ensure all components are stored, assembled, tightened and operated as specified within this document.2. KEY ITEMS OF IMPORTANCE2.1 Summarised Essentials Pocket SlipThis pocket slip contains a dot point summary of some of the most important operationalrequirements and helpful tips. The card can be printed out and used as a guide when operating the lifter. This card is to be used as a prompt tool only and does not replace the need to read and understand the Operations and Maintenance Manual.2.2 Summarised Essentials ListThis list below is identical to the wording on the printable pocket slip in section 2.1.∙Do not use the lifting equipment if any part of the equipment appears damaged.∙Only operate equipment if competent and authorised to do so.∙Conveyor system must be isolated with belt restrained.∙Mounting areas on the conveyor stringers must be relatively clean with large debris wiped away prior to set-up.∙Only use the Techmine hydraulic pump to operate the lifter.∙Lifter hydraulic telescopes sections must be assembled tightly together by hand.∙Hydraulic telescopes must be positioned with the retaining lip toe-in on the stringers (Allowable gap is 0-10mm between the lip and stringer).∙Flanged M24 nuts must be done up hand tight plus a ¼ turn extra using a mechanical aid.∙Adjustable rigging assemblies or solid lifting beams should be set in position as centrally under the belt as possible.∙Rigging chain assemblies may be used when secured no more than 2 links higher or lower to the opposing side.∙Monitor system pressure during operation and never exceed the equipment’s maximum rated working load limit.∙If an uneven lift is experienced, the system will synchronise at ¼ creep speed when holding the raise button down.∙//OR//∙Alternately, operating the power pack repeatedly using 1 second on / 4 seconds off will fully extend the lagging cylinder.∙Always install, secure and lower the lifter onto the locking pins before commencing belt maintenance.3. MAINTENANCEIt is essential that a regular maintenance and inspection program be implemented for all lifting equipment. Such a program will result in more reliable operation, longer equipment life and ensure the equipment operates safely during every maintenance activity. Equipment that is properly maintained will operate dependably, providing the longest possible duration in trouble free service.The maintenance recommended in this document is presented as a guide and should be considered as a minimum requirement. However, the maintenance of the equipment should be modified and/or added to in the light of experience with the plant involved and the changing operating conditions.8.1 Bleeding Air from SystemAir within the hydraulic system is the cause of numerous problems with the lifter operation. Air ingress must be rectified by bleeding the air from the system at the soonest opportunity. The effects of air ingress on the systems performance can be viewed in Section 11- Troubleshooting.With both the cylinder telescope connected to the hydraulic power pack, cycle the cylinders 3 times up and down to remove any air trapped internally. As the cylinders retract, any fugitive air venting from the system will cause an audible gurgling noise within the oil reservoir. If air can still be heard venting on the 3rd. cycle, keep cycling the cylinders until no more audible air is present in the system. If air still can be heard on the 5th cycle, leave the hydraulic pump still for30 minutes allowing any emulsion in the oil reservoir to dissipate. After the rest period, thesystem should only take a maximum of 3 cycles to complete the bleeding operation.8.2 Rigging and Lifting Componentry- Quarterly InspectionThoroughly inspect all lifting equipment on a quarterly basis using a qualified and competent rigger. It is recommended to tag the inspected and approved equipment using a colour coded tagging system or similar.8.3 Hydraulic Telescope Contamination- Cleaning ProcedureIf excessive dirt, oily scum or other foreign matter has entered the void between the hydraulic cylinder and outer telescope, and is affecting the lifters raise and retraction performance, the following steps may be required to remove the contamination;∙Both telescope assemblies must be cleaned, even if only one of the hydraulic telescopes is suffering from contamination.∙Connect both cylinders to the hydraulic pump and fully extend cylinders.∙Wipe dirt or contaminants off the cylinder tube.∙Wipe dirt or contaminants off the painted outer telescope tubes.If required, the cylinder telescope and tube can be washed down externally and internally using warm soapy water at residential tap pressure.∙Retract the cylinders.∙Fill the telescope/cylinder cavity with soapy water through the locking pin holes. Shake the cylinder telescope assembly for 30 seconds allowing the warm soapy water time to react with any residual dirt and/or oil trapped on the inside surfaces of the telescope assembly.∙Slowly extend the cylinders once again, allowing the soapy water to escape and drain.∙Whilst the cylinders are extended gently flush the inside cavity by squirting water down one of the locking pin holes for 20-30 seconds.∙Wipe down the cylinder and painted outer telescope tubes with a rag if needed.∙Retract the cylinders and allow them to dry. Once dry, the lifter parts can be placed back into its protective case for storage.Note: In lieu of soap, a biodegradable and non-toxic degreasing fluid can be used to clean down the entire cylinder assembly.DO NOT USE INDUSTRIAL SOLVENTS SUCH AS THINNERS, EMULSIFIERS, ACIDS, ALKALIES OR OTHER CHEMICALS THAT MAY REMOVE OR DAMAGE EPOXY or POLYETHYLENE PAINTS.8.4 Maintenance Records and SummaryA record should be maintained to log the work carried out on each maintenance inspection. Orifice Assy: Minerals deposits on orifice can cause water flow to spurt or not regulate. Mineral deposits may be removed from the orifice with a small round file not over 1/8" diameter or a small diameter wire. CAUTION: Do not file or cut orifice materials.2. Stream Regulator: If orifice is free of material deposits regulate water flow according to instructions on page3.3. Sensor Control: The sensor has a 2 second delay time. If sensor fails to operate valve mechanism or operates erratically, check the following: a) Ensure there are no obstructions within a 40 inch radius from the front of fountain.b) Check wire connections at the solenoid valve and at the sensor.CAUTION: Make sure unit is unplugged before checking any wiring. c) Ensure proper operation of solenoid valve. If there is an audible clicking sound yet no water flows, look for an obstruction in the valve itself or elsewhere in the water supply line.WARNING: Do not expose sensor to direct sunlight.4. Sensor Range Adjustment: The electronic sensor used in this fountain is factory pre-set for a "visual" range of 36 inches. If actual range varies greatly from this, or a different setting is desired, follow the range adjustment procedure below:a) Remove bottom cover of fountain.b) Remove sensor by removing washers and nuts that secure sensor on studs.c) Locate range adjustment screw between the red lenses of the sensor, then with a small tip screwdriver, rotate the range adjusting screw clockwise to increase range or counter-clockwise to decrease range. 1/4 turn of screw is equal to approximately 12 - 18 inches of range.CAUTION: Complete range of sensor (24 - 46 inches) is only one turn of the adjusting screw.d) Remount sensor on studs and replace bottom cover.241922FIG. 7REPAIR SERVICE INFORMATION TOLL FREE NUMBER 1.800.260.6640MF100 Mounting Frame。

1.简介装柜专家LoadExpert是一个解决集装箱装柜问题的专业软件。
“装柜专家”采用先进的数学模型,集合优秀的程序算法,紧密联系实际应用需求。
它能智能优化集装箱内货物空间布局,提高集装箱的空间利用率,得出明确清晰的货物装载方案,规范标准化作业某些集装箱的最多数量,自动计算出利用所选集装箱,完全装载这批货物所需的最节省运费的方案,并可以指定各种货物在集装箱内部从里到外的空间装柜顺序。
操作步骤如下:1.选择“文件”菜单,选择“新建”。
出现选择装柜方式窗口。
选择“多货多柜”,单击右下角的“确定”按钮,进入下一步。
2.进入主操作界面。
在右方的浏览树选择“货物”项,开始选择货物。
右方出现货物选择列表,选中货物之后,单击“选择”按钮,或者双击货物列表中该项,就可以选择该货物到下面的装柜货物列表中。
装柜专家默认为你设置了这种货物的数量是100件,点击各种货物的数量栏,就可以输入各种货物的数量,同样地也可以编辑这种货物的空间装柜顺序。
装柜专家规定了空间装柜顺序是从0-99的整数,空间装柜顺序高的货物比低的货物先装载入集装箱之内。
如果要在装柜货物列表中取消选择某种集装箱,只需在下方的装柜货物列表中选择这种货物,点击右下角的“取消选择”按钮即可。
